Greenhouse operations require specific personal protective equipment to safeguard workers from chemical exposure, UV radiation, and physical hazards. Essential protective gear includes respiratory protection, eye and face protection, chemical-resistant gloves, protective clothing, and slip-resistant footwear. The right equipment prevents injuries and ensures compliance with safety regulations while maintaining productivity in greenhouse environments.
What types of protective equipment are essential for greenhouse workers?
Greenhouse workers need respiratory protection, eye and face protection, hand protection, protective clothing, and appropriate footwear to work safely. Each type addresses specific hazards common in controlled growing environments where chemicals, UV exposure, and physical risks are present daily.
Respiratory protection includes disposable masks for dust and particulates, as well as cartridge respirators for chemical applications. Eye protection encompasses safety glasses with UV filtering and face shields for splash protection during pesticide applications. Chemical-resistant gloves made from nitrile or neoprene protect hands from fertilisers, pesticides, and cleaning solutions.
Protective clothing ranges from lightweight coveralls for general work to chemical-resistant suits for pesticide applications. Long-sleeved shirts and trousers protect against UV exposure from grow lights and glass structures. Footwear must be slip-resistant with closed toes, while rubber boots are necessary when working with wet chemicals or irrigation systems.
How do you choose the right respiratory protection for greenhouse chemicals?
Selecting appropriate respiratory protection depends on the specific chemicals used and their concentration levels. N95 masks filter particulates but don’t protect against vapours, while P100 filters offer higher particulate protection. Half-face and full-face respirators with appropriate cartridges are necessary for chemical vapours and gases.
N95 respirators work for dust, pollen, and dry fertiliser applications. P100 filters are better for fine particulates and biological contaminants. Half-face respirators with organic vapour cartridges protect against most pesticides and solvents. Full-face respirators provide additional eye protection and are required for highly toxic chemicals.
Proper fit testing ensures the respirator seals correctly against your face. Clean-shaven workers achieve better seals than those with facial hair. Replace cartridges according to manufacturer guidelines or when breathing becomes difficult. Store respirators in clean, dry locations away from chemicals and direct sunlight.
What safety regulations govern protective gear in greenhouse operations?
OSHA standards and EPA Worker Protection Standards establish minimum requirements for personal protective equipment in greenhouse operations. These regulations specify when protective gear is mandatory, training requirements, and employer responsibilities for maintaining safe working conditions.
OSHA’s Personal Protective Equipment standards require employers to assess workplace hazards and provide appropriate protective gear at no cost to workers. The EPA Worker Protection Standard specifically addresses agricultural pesticide use, requiring protective equipment during mixing, loading, and application activities.
Employers must train workers on proper equipment use, maintenance, and limitations. Documentation requirements include hazard assessments, training records, and equipment inspection logs. Workers have the right to receive protective equipment and training before exposure to hazardous materials.
How often should protective equipment be replaced or maintained?
Protective equipment requires regular inspection and replacement based on usage frequency, exposure levels, and manufacturer recommendations. Daily visual inspections identify damage, while formal weekly inspections document equipment condition and replacement needs.
Respirator cartridges need replacement when breathing becomes difficult, odours are detected, or after maximum use periods specified by manufacturers. Gloves should be replaced immediately if punctured, cracked, or chemically degraded. Protective clothing requires replacement when the fabric becomes worn, torn, or contaminated beyond cleaning.
Clean equipment after each use with appropriate cleaning agents. Store protective gear in clean, dry locations away from chemicals and extreme temperatures. Maintain records of inspection dates, replacement schedules, and any equipment failures. Budget for regular replacement costs as part of operational expenses.

Can I use the same gloves for all greenhouse tasks, or do I need different types?
You need different gloves for different tasks. Use nitrile gloves for general chemical handling, neoprene for pesticide applications, and cut-resistant gloves when handling sharp tools or glass. Never use the same pair of gloves for food handling and chemical work, as cross-contamination can occur even after cleaning.
What should I do if my respirator fogs up while working in humid greenhouse conditions?
Fogging indicates improper fit or expired anti-fog treatments. Ensure your respirator is properly fitted and consider models with exhalation valves that reduce moisture buildup. Clean the lens with anti-fog solution and check that face seals aren't compromised by moisture or sweat.
How do I know when chemical-resistant clothing has been compromised and needs replacement?
Look for visible signs like discoloration, stiffness, cracking, or fabric degradation. If chemicals penetrate through to your skin or underlying clothing, replace immediately. Some chemical damage isn't visible, so follow manufacturer guidelines for maximum exposure times and replace protective clothing after heavy chemical use sessions.
Is it safe to wash and reuse disposable protective equipment to save costs?
Never reuse equipment labeled as disposable, especially respirators and chemical-resistant suits. Washing can compromise protective barriers and create false security. While some reusable equipment can be cleaned according to manufacturer instructions, disposable items must be discarded after single use to maintain safety standards.
What's the best way to store protective equipment in a greenhouse environment?
Store equipment in a clean, dry area away from direct sunlight, chemicals, and temperature extremes. Use dedicated storage cabinets or lockers with ventilation to prevent moisture buildup. Keep clean and contaminated equipment separated, and ensure storage areas are easily accessible but secure from unauthorized use.
How can I ensure my workers actually wear protective equipment consistently?
Implement regular training sessions, lead by example, and make equipment easily accessible at work stations. Establish clear consequences for non-compliance while addressing comfort concerns that might discourage use. Regular safety meetings and positive reinforcement for proper PPE use create a culture where protection becomes routine rather than optional.
What should I do if a worker has an allergic reaction to protective equipment materials?
Immediately remove the equipment and seek medical attention if symptoms are severe. Document the incident and identify alternative materials - for example, switch from latex to nitrile gloves for latex allergies. Consult with suppliers about hypoallergenic alternatives and ensure all workers are aware of potential allergens in protective equipment.
